Island Murter

Island Murter – the island of amazing variety of nature, beautiful, sandy and stone beaches, the cultural center since Roman times marked with numerous historical heritage, traditions many years tourism, hospitality and diligence of the island’s population. Island Murter belongs to the group northern Dalmatian islands and is the largest island in the Sibenik archipelago. It is separated from the mainland by narrow sea channel, which in some places only 6m wide. In Tisno Murter is with the mainland by movable bridge back in 1832 g.

Jezera

Jezera is typically small Dalmatian town located on the southeast side of the island Murter. It was named after the small lakes that are formed in the fall and winter days when water is poured into the karst valleys.

Jezera is populated back in 1298th when in the bay is well protected from wind and waves come first settlers. In the natural harbor today is located nautical center and a modern marina with 250 berths.

Jezera has many cultural monuments, but particularly should emphasize the church Our Lady of Health from 1720. year, which was built by master Jure Foretic.

Betina

Betina is a small impressive tourist resort located in the northeastern coast of the island Murter. It is rich in natural, cultural and economic peculiarities.
